Design Juxtaposition by Space Group Architects

Design Juxtaposition is one of my favorite elements when it comes to architecture. Space Group Architects has done a stellar job reimagining this older building with a modern minimal esthetic. I like seeing the crisp clean lines of the interiors mixed with the old brick and wood beams from the original structure. The use of space is nicely done especially with the bathroom situation. There is a nice mix of materials including copper, walnut, stone, and plain flat white surfaces. The place is currently on the market in London, set in the Tredagar Square conservation area. I would have no problems calling this place home.
